Hydraulic breaker
Fragments with impact energy; works independently of material type.
Where it wins
- The only option in massive, unfissured rock and reinforced concrete
- Point work: you can target a specific block or area
- Does what a ripper cannot in concrete and reinforced structures
- Controlled progress in confined spaces and at height
Where it falls short
- Slower and more expensive than a ripper on layered ground
- Tool wear and lubrication are a continuous cost
- Noise and vibration bring restrictions in built-up areas
